The Evolution of Cognitive Enhancement in the Digital Era

Over the past decade, the landscape of self-improvement has dramatically shifted owing to the proliferation of mobile applications aimed at enhancing cognitive functioning. From traditional puzzles to sophisticated neurofeedback programs, the options are vast. Industry data indicates that the global brain training market is projected to reach $6.6 billion by 2025, driven largely by smartphone adoption among younger and aging populations alike.[1] These tools promise improved memory, focus, and mental agility, but their scientific validity often varies, emphasizing the importance of credible, evidence-based solutions.

Industry Insights: The Credibility of Mobile Cognitive Tools

Critical to the adoption and trustworthiness of these tools is their foundation in neuroscience. Leading apps leverage cognitive science research, integrating gamified approaches to facilitate neuroplasticity—the brain’s ability to reorganize itself by forming new neural connections. However, discerning quality applications from superficial ones calls for rigorous curation and validation, often lacking in the saturated app stores.

Industry standards now emphasize transparency, with credible developers providing scientific references, clinical trial data, or expert endorsements. For the tech-savvy user, this trend signifies a shift towards evidence-based digital health products that prioritize user safety and tangible results.

Mobile Applications and Scientific Validation: The Case for Credibility

While many apps are available, only a subset demonstrates peer-reviewed validation or clinical testing. For consumers, choosing a reputable app involves considering:

  • Scientific references or backing from neuroscientists
  • User testimonials and independent reviews
  • Transparency about data and privacy policies
  • Integration of features like progress tracking and adaptive difficulty

Developers increasingly recognize these criteria, and some have begun publishing their methodologies and results openly, bolstering their credibility.
